ISPR: Two soldiers martyred in terror attack along Pakistan-Iran border
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

RAWALPINDI: The Inter-Services Public Relations (ISPR) announced on Thursday that two soldiers valiantly laid down their lives during a shootout with terrorists at a security forces post in Singwan, a region bordering Iran in the district of Kech, Balochistan.

According to a statement issued by the military’s media wing, a group of terrorists launched an attack on the security forces’ post, but their assault was repelled by the alert and well-prepared deployed troops. A fierce exchange of gunfire ensued, with the soldiers courageously utilizing all available weaponry.

“Amidst the intense firefight, two brave soldiers, identified as Sepoy Hasnain Ishtiaq, 34, and Sepoy Inayat Ullah, 27, embraced martyrdom while fearlessly fighting against the terrorists,” read the official statement.

Providing additional information about the fallen soldiers, the ISPR revealed that Sepoy Ishtiaq hailed from Dera Ghazi Khan district, while Sepoy Inayat was a resident of Jhal Magsi district.

In response to the attack, an immediate sanitization operation was launched in the area, and contact was established with Iranian authorities to ensure the terrorists had no chance to escape.

“Security Forces, in complete alignment with the nation, remain resolute in their determination to thwart any attempts aimed at sabotaging peace and stability along the Balochistan borders,” stated the ISPR.

In a separate operation conducted a day earlier, security forces successfully eliminated two terrorists in South Waziristan district of Khyber Pakhtunkhwa province.

The ISPR disclosed that the security forces carried out an intelligence-based operation in the Dossali area, acting on credible information regarding the presence of terrorists.

“During the operation, an intense exchange of fire occurred between security forces and the terrorists, resulting in the elimination of two terrorists,” stated the ISPR. Additionally, a significant cache of weapons and ammunition was recovered from the militants.

The military’s media wing further revealed that the terrorists had been actively involved in anti-security forces activities and the senseless killing of innocent citizens.

Sanitization efforts are currently underway in the area to eradicate any remaining presence of terrorists.

The ISPR also highlighted the local community’s appreciation for the operation, as they expressed full support in the collective endeavor to eliminate the menace of terrorism.
